Bhubaneswar, the capital city of Odisha, is known for its rich cultural heritage and ancient temples that attract tourists from all over the world. The city is home to some of the most magnificent temples in India that are not only important religious sites but also architectural wonders.
One of the most popular temples in Bhubaneswar is the Lingaraj Temple, which is dedicated to Lord Shiva. It is one of the oldest and largest temples in the city and is known for its beautiful carvings and sculptures. Another famous temple in Bhubaneswar is the Mukteswara Temple, which is renowned for its intricate carvings and sculptures of the various Hindu deities.
Other popular temples in Bhubaneswar include the Rajarani Temple, Ananta Vasudeva Temple, and the Brahmeswara Temple. These temples are known for their unique architecture, exquisite carvings, and religious significance.
The temples in Bhubaneswar also play an important role in the city’s festivals and cultural events. The annual Rath Yatra, a grand procession of Lord Jagannath, takes place in the city and is attended by thousands of devotees from across the country.
Overall, the temples in Bhubaneswar are a testament to the city’s rich cultural heritage and offer visitors a chance to explore the ancient traditions and beliefs of India. The city is a must-visit destination for anyone interested in history, architecture, and religion.
